English for Speakers of Other Languages (ESOL)
 
Savannah Technical College offers English for Speakers of Other Languages (ESOL) as part of its developmental course offerings. The classes are designed to develop the English language skills of students whose native language is not English. Classes are offered at three levels: Beginning, Intermediate, and Advanced. Each level contains four courses that are designed to be taken simultaneously: Listening and Speaking, Grammar Communication, Reading, and Composition.

Frequently Asked Questions

   

How long is the ESOL program?

 

Each student moves through the ESOL program at his/her own pace. Generally, most students complete the ESOL program in 18 months.

 

How much do the ESOL classes cost?

 

The tuition rate for the ESOL classes is the same as for regular college classes.   
 

Does Savannah Technical College recognize English proficiency tests such as TOEFL or IELTS?

 

Currently, Savannah Technical College does not use TOEFL or IELTS scores to determine your level of English proficiency. Instead, we use the COMPASS ESL, which is the placement test you will take as part of the admissions process. If you did well on TOEFL or IELTS, then you should do well on COMPASS ESL.

 

What can I do after I finish the ESOL program?

 

The ESOL program is designed to prepare you for study in an American college or university. So, you may enroll in any of Savannah Technical College’s programs. Certain program restrictions apply to international students with F1 non-immigrant status.

 

Will another college or university recognize the ESOL classes at Savannah Tech?

 

Because the ESOL classes are part of Savannah Tech’s developmental course offerings, another college or university will not recognize them. However, after you complete the ESOL program, you may take ENG 1101, Composition and Rhetoric, which is recognized by other colleges.
 
 
 
 
 
The classes in this program are not covered by state or federal financial aid.
